The first batch of Nigerians evacuated from South Africa by the federal government arrived this morning aboard special flight belonging to Airpeace, a major carrier in the Nigeria airspace.The flight touched down at Murtala Mohammed International Airport, this thursday morning, in accordance with the FG promise.The Director General of Nigerians in Diaspora Commission, Mrs Abike Dabiri- Erewa, was on ground to oversee the whole operations. From the grapevine, each evacuee will be given #50,000 MTN air time and also a cash of #100,000 for Local transportation.The passengers were accompanied by the representatives of Nigerian Mission, based in South Africa.The reality is that, the federal government acted based on the Xenophobic attacks mated on Nigerians and other African nationals by South Africans. The attacks led to loss of many lives and businesses shot dow, while the government of South Africa allegedly looked away.Some of the returnees were visibly shaken and described the whole episode as unfortunate treatment from fellow African Country.One of them who spoke under the condition of anonymity told Upright Media that she spent 13 years in South Africa and is now back to Nigeria, leaving all she laboured with her husband behind.


She recalled that, living in South Africa was not easy but had to manage all the years she lived there because of the condition also at home–Nigeria.” i regret all the years i spent in South Africa with my family. I am even scared that, the situation that drove me out many years ago is what i have come back to face with my little children. I appeal to the Nigerian government to come to our aid because we did not commit any crime just that our host country ( South Africa), did not want our presence in that country anymore”.The cargo area of the MMIA where the returnees were profiled and documented by various agencies of government as at the time this report was filed was full of activities, even as the Federal Airport Authority of Nigeria (FAAN), made sure that, the returnees were treated nicely and dispersed seamlessly from the airport environment.
